Upgrades agent-acp-kit to 0.7.8, preserves exact Agent Target identity and executable paths, keeps composer defaults inside the kit while retaining UI metadata, makes custom commands and packaging shell-free and portable, and adds a Windows packaged bootstrap E2E with a native tutti.exe in a path containing spaces and a completed real Agent run. Tests: pnpm check; 138 package tests; pnpm package:tutti. Independent review found no remaining P0-P2.
